Blender高效建模:降低多边形数量及优化技巧395


Blender是一款功能强大的开源3D建模软件,其强大的功能也意味着模型的复杂度可能迅速飙升,导致文件变大、渲染时间延长,甚至电脑卡顿。因此,学习如何“减轻”Blender模型,也就是降低多边形数量并优化模型,对于提高工作效率和最终渲染效果至关重要。本文将深入探讨在Blender中高效减面的各种方法和技巧,帮助您创建更轻量级、更高效的3D模型。

一、 理解多边形的重要性

在Blender中,多边形是构成模型的基本单元。多边形数量越多,模型越精细,细节也越丰富,但这同时也意味着更高的系统资源消耗。过多的多边形不仅会减慢渲染速度,还会影响建模过程的流畅性。因此,在建模过程中需要权衡模型的细节与效率之间的关系,根据实际需要控制多边形数量。

二、 建模阶段的减面技巧

最好的减面方式是在建模阶段就控制多边形数量,避免后期大量的修改。以下是一些在建模过程中高效控制多边形数量的方法:
使用低多边形建模方法: 尽量避免过度细分模型。在开始建模时,就应该规划好模型的拓扑结构,尽量使用较少的边和面来表达模型的主要形状。可以使用简单的几何体,例如立方体、球体和圆柱体作为基础,然后逐步添加细节。
合理的循环细分: 如果需要更精细的模型,可以使用循环细分(Loop Cut and Slide),在需要细节的地方进行局部细分,而不是全局细分。这可以有效地控制多边形数量。
镜像建模: 利用镜像修改器可以减少建模工作量,并保证模型的对称性,从而降低多边形数量。
使用合适的拓扑结构: 良好的拓扑结构可以使模型变形更自然,并且更容易进行细分和减面。避免使用过多的三角形面,尽量使用四边形面。

三、 后期减面技术

即使在建模阶段已经注意控制多边形数量,后期可能仍然需要进行减面操作。Blender提供了多种减面工具,可以根据不同的需求选择合适的方法:
手动删除面: 对于简单的模型,可以直接手动选择并删除多余的面,这是一个精确控制多边形数量的方法,但效率较低。
Decimate Modifier: 这是一个非常强大的减面修改器,可以根据不同的算法减少多边形数量。它提供了多种选项,例如Collapse, Planar, and UnSubdivide,可以根据模型的特点选择合适的算法。 可以调整Ratio参数控制减面程度,预览结果并调整参数以达到最佳效果。
Remesh Modifier: 这个修改器会重新生成模型的网格,减少多边形数量的同时保留模型的基本形状。它可以根据不同的算法进行重构,例如Voxel Remesh和Smooth Remesh,可以根据模型的特性选择合适的算法。 可以调整Octree Depth参数控制网格的密度。
Multiresolution Modifier: 这允许在不同的分辨率级别上编辑模型,可以先在低分辨率下修改,再逐步增加分辨率添加细节。 这对需要保留模型细节但又需要降低多边形数量的情况非常有用。


四、 优化技巧

除了减面,还可以通过以下技巧来优化模型:
清理几何体: 使用Blender的清理工具去除冗余的顶点、边和面,可以减小文件大小并提高渲染速度。
合并几何体: 如果模型由多个物体组成,可以将它们合并成一个物体,减少渲染开销。
使用材质球优化: 合理使用材质球可以减少渲染时间,例如使用相同的材质球可以减少渲染器的工作量。
烘焙法线贴图: 对于高精度模型,可以烘焙法线贴图,在渲染时使用法线贴图代替高精度模型,可以显著减少渲染时间。

五、 总结

降低Blender模型的多边形数量是一个复杂的过程,需要结合建模技巧和后期处理技术。 记住,最有效的策略是在建模过程中就注重控制多边形数量,并选择适合自己模型的减面和优化方法。 通过熟练掌握这些方法,您可以创建更轻量级、更高效的3D模型,提高工作效率并获得更好的渲染效果。

2025-03-04


上一篇:CorelDRAW黑线困扰?彻底解决恼人轮廓线的方法

下一篇:CorelDRAW水滴效果制作详解:从基础形状到逼真质感